Two related fixes for OAuth login failures:
- `UserSchema`: backend (Facebook/Apple) returns `null` for fields like
`email`; Zod's `.default("")` rejects `null`, causing silent login
failures. Introduce `stringOrEmpty` / `numberOrZero` / `booleanOrFalse`
helpers (`nullable().transform(v => v ?? x).default(x)`) and apply
across the schema so input accepts `string | null | undefined` while
output stays the typed primitive.
- `SplashScreen`: render `state.errorMessage` (set by auth state machine
`onError`, e.g. Facebook sync / schema mismatch) so users no longer
get stuck on splash without feedback.

Next.js Image scans only inline style for 'auto' to determine whether
sizing is fully delegated to CSS. The .logo class already sets
height: var(--auth-logo-height) and width: auto, but the inline auto
hint is required to suppress the width/height-modified warning.
Applies to both auth-facebook-panel and auth-email-panel where the same
login logo is rendered.

- chat-screen no longer manages WebSocket directly; it now dispatches three
auth lifecycle events (ChatGuestLogin, ChatNonGuestLogin, ChatLogout)
derived from auth.loginStatus
- chat-machine internally owns the WebSocket long-lived actor via
fromCallback, completing the previously deferred migration scope
- removed ChatWebSocket import, getWsToken helper, and direct WS
effect from chat-screen; renamed dispatchInitialLoad to
dispatchAuthLifecycle to reflect the new responsibility
- decouples auth from chat machine via event-driven boundary: machine
stays unaware of loginStatus, guest semantics live at the dispatch
layer (guest → skip WS, non-guest → connect with token)
The screen-lifecycle events were dead code: the transitions in chat-machine
(idle <-> ready) had no caller behavior tied to them, and the dispatches
in chat-screen.tsx were the only senders. Drop the union members, both
state transitions, and the mount-effect dispatches.
The idle state remains declared as initial but is no longer reachable
at runtime; can be refactored in a follow-up.
